Members of Congress represent diverse communities, and Home Field Advantage demonstrates the importance of local, place-based roots in their campaigns, election outcomes, and relationships with constituents. Charles Hunt's research shows that these roots have a significant and independent impact on election outcomes, performance, campaign spending, and constituent communication styles, which are not fully explained by partisanship, incumbency, or other established theories. He presents a "Theory of Local Roots" and demonstrates its influence empirically using original measures of local roots over a cross-section of legislators and a significant period of time.

Members of Congress, representing diverse communities across the country, play a crucial role in shaping American politics. While partisan polarization often garners significant attention in political science scholarship, the local, place-based roots that members of Congress have in their home districts remain an understudied element. In his book "Home Field Advantage," Charles Hunt explores the profound impact of these local roots on congressional campaigns, election outcomes, and the broader relationship between representatives and constituents.
Hunt argues that legislators' local roots in their district exert a significant and independent influence on their campaigns, election results, and the overall dynamics between members of the U.S. House of Representatives and their constituents. Through original data analysis, his research reveals that a multitude of factors, beyond partisanship, incumbency, or conventional theories of American political representation, contribute to variations in election outcomes, performance relative to presidential candidates, campaign spending, and constituent communication styles.
Rather than being solely attributed to partisanship or other well-established factors, many of these differences arise from the depth of a legislator's local roots, which predate their time in Congress. Hunt presents a comprehensive "Theory of Local Roots" to explain this influence and demonstrates its empirical significance using a range of original measures of local roots across a diverse sample of legislators and a substantial period of time.
